Stocks Regaining Ground But Drop By Disney Weighing On The Dow

ollowing the pullback seen over the two previous sessions, stocks have regained some ground in morning trading on Thursday. The tech-heavy Nasdaq has shown a notable rebound, while the S&P 500 has also moved to the upside. Currently, the Nasdaq is up 120.52 points or 0.8 percent at 15,743.23 and the S&P 500 is up 10.79 points or 0.2 percent at 4,657.50. The Dow has bucked the uptrend, however, with the blue chip index slipping 81.07 points or 0.2 percent at 35,998.87.
